Tony secured his PhD in Quality Management in Healthcare and is currently enrolled in a
PhD in Pure Maths at UQ. He is Associate Professor, Faculty of Health Science and
Medicine at Bond University. In the twenty one years from 1990, he was Laboratories
Manager, Executive Manager at Sullivan Nicolaides Pathology. Between 1973 and 1990, he
worked at the Biochemistry Department of the Princess Alexandra Hospital. 

As evidence of his international reputation in biochemistry, Tony has travelled
frequently and widely to be the visiting guest lecturer and invited speaker in countries
such as India, Indonesia, Vietnam, Singapore, the Philippines and Malaysia as well as to
the New Zealand and Britain. In fact, he has presented 130 papers at Conferences and
Regional Meetings. He was President of the Australasian Association of Clinical
Biochemists (2003-2007), and has been a visiting guest lecturer under the auspices of the
International Federation of Clinical Chemistry and the Asian Pacific Federation of
Clinical Biochemistry. 

Tony has also had published 85 Papers/ Abstracts and one book chapter (2 editions) in
Health care management and has reviewed a number of esteemed scientific journals. He was
consultant and adviser to WHO in 2007; adviser to the Department of Health and Ageing on
the Scientific Workforce in Pathology and is a Ministerial appointee to the National
Pathology Accreditation Advisory Committee.
